The GRE is a standardised admissions test that is used to test the calibre of applicants aspiring to study a postgraduate programme abroad, especially in the USA. With a special focus on Science and Engineering, an excellent GRE score is considered extremely crucial in finding a place at a popular university.

But did you know that many top-class American universities have done away with the need for a student to submit a GRE score? Yes, you can join a postgraduate programme in the USA without writing the GRE. The detailed list given below consolidates the names of various American universities where you can study specific MS programmes without submitting a GRE score.

Top Universities in the USA without GRE/GMAT for MS

California Institute of Technology

Caltech ranks 6th as per the Times Higher Education World University Rankings 2023. The Caltech website says that GRE tests are not required for graduate admissions and the test scores will not be considered. 

Georgetown University

The School of Continuing Studies at Georgetown University does not require GRE/GMAT scores for admissions to their graduate programmes. Scores will not be reviewed even if submitted.

Emory University

GRE/GMAT is not required for applying to their Laney Graduate School except for the programmes such as Biostatistics, Business, Islamic Civilisation Studies, Political Science and Sociology.

The University of Maryland

Its Robert H. Smith School of Business will continue to waive GRE/GMAT requirements provided the candidates meet other criteria.

Michigan State University

At Michigan, submitting GRE/GMAT scores is currently optional (for Spring 2023 and Fall 2023).

The University of North Carolina Chapel Hill

Applicants who have 5 or more years of professional experience need not submit GRE/GMAT scores for admission to their MBA programmes. Others can also apply for a GRE/GMAT score waiver if they think they qualify for an exemption.

Apart from these, MIT Sloan and the University of Chicago allow candidates to request a test waiver, provided you confirm that you cannot attempt the test in-person or virtually. Institutions like Princeton University and the University of California, Berkley do not have a minimum score requirement for applications.

Is GRE compulsory for MS in the USA?

Not all universities in the USA demand GRE/GMAT scores from their candidates. Owing to the pandemic, a lot more institutions have waived this requirement.

Some other institutions have made this test-optional – meaning, submitting the scores is not required, but it is accepted.

Certain other universities are willing to waive the requirement, provided you meet other eligibility requirements, for example, 5 years of work experience.

Check with your institution to understand the admission criteria better.

When do universities allow GRE waivers?

Exceptional GPA

Some universities choose to waive off the GRE/GMAT score if your grade point average is above 3.3 on a scale of 0 to 4. So it pays to focus on your undergraduate degree and achieve an excellent GPA.

Work Experience  

Some universities waive off the GRE/GMAT if you have relevant work experience of four years or more that is closely related to the degree that you aim to study. 

Undergraduate Research Projects

There have been instances in the past wherein exceptional undergraduate research projects executed by students have led to the students being offered a place to study in leading universities.

FAQs about Universities in the USA without GRE and GMAT

Does MBA require GRE or GMAT?

Most business schools abroad will require one of the two tests for admission to their MBA programme – either the GRE (Graduate Record Examinations) or the GMAT (Graduate Management Admission Test). However, some institutions like the University of North Chapel Hill in the USA waive test score requirements for candidates with more than 5 years of professional experience.

Is GMAT waived for 2023?

Owing to the pandemic, several universities in the USA have decided to waive GRE/GMAT requirements. However, some allow students to submit it if they wish to. The conditions can vary. Hence it is advisable to check with our experts or with the institution to confirm the entry requirements.

Are all universities waiving GRE/GMAT requirements?

Not all universities are waiving GRE/GMAT requirements. For example, the University of Tennessee at Knoxville mandates that students should submit their GRE/GMAT scores to be considered for admission to their MBA programmes.

Does Harvard prefer GRE or GMAT?

Harvard’s GRE and GMAT test score requirement varies by programme. But the university does not have a preferred test. The requirement is that you should submit the official scores for consideration.
